Description

The project aims to reduce inequalities between the vulnerable Venezuelan population and members of host communities compared to host populations in general, as well as strengthen resilience in host communities. Specifically, it aims to improve various aspects of socio-economic inclusion, including the development of economic opportunities of vulnerable populations, both members of host communities and migrant and refugee populations. In addition, it aims to improve the quality and accessibility of basic infrastructures and services, especially those related to health and COVID-19.
